Поддержка dialup

FreeBSD, NetBSD, OpenBSD, DragonFly и т. д.

Модератор: arachnid

Джон
Сообщения: 8

Поддержка dialup

Сообщение Джон »

Помогите, пожалуйста, установить в FreeBSD поддержку dialup'а. Заранее спасибо
Спасибо сказали:
Аватара пользователя
vg2.0
Сообщения: 832
Статус: *BSD admin ;)
ОС: *BSD =)

Re: Поддержка dialup

Сообщение vg2.0 »

Помогите, пожалуйста, установить в FreeBSD поддержку dialup'а. Заранее спасибо

Поддержку где в ядре, или настроить соединение?
Если второе выложу свой конфиг когда приду домой.
FreeBSD 6-stable
FreeBSD 5.5-stable
Спасибо сказали:
Аватара пользователя
zenwolf
Бывший модератор
Сообщения: 3139
Статус: Страшный и злой
ОС: Slackware..Salix..x86_64

Re: Поддержка dialup

Сообщение zenwolf »

она по умолчанию есть в генерик ,действительно чего надо ?
ppp.conf настраивается просто
Quae videmus quo dependet vultus. (лат) - То, что мы видим, зависит от того, куда мы смотрим.
Спасибо сказали:
Джон
Сообщения: 8

Re: Поддержка dialup

Сообщение Джон »

Я имею в виду подключение по модему с Интернетом. Установлена FreeBSD 5.2. Вот, пытаюсь всё это дело настроить ...

<_<
Спасибо сказали:
Аватара пользователя
polachok
Бывший модератор
Сообщения: 2199
Статус: главный форумный маргинал
ОС: gnu/linux

Re: Поддержка dialup

Сообщение polachok »

в /etc/ppp/ppp.conf

default:
set phone 4384242
set device /dev/cual0
set speed 115200
set dial "ABORT BUSY ABORT NO\\sCARRIER TIMEOUT 5 \"\" AT \
OK-AT-OK ATE1Q0 OK \\dATDP\\T TIMEOUT 60 CONNECT"
set authname "e9ysuP72"
set authkey "8v7nt96u"
set timeout 120
set ifaddr 10.0.0.1/0 10.0.0.2/0 255.255.255.0 0.0.0.0
add default HISADDR
enable dns
PTN:
set phone 5957272
set dial "ABORT BUSY ABORT NO\\sCARRIER TIMEOUT 5 \"\" AT \
OK-AT-OK ATE1Q0 OK \\dATDP\\T TIMEOUT 60 CONNECT"
set authname "PTN"
set authkey "PTN"
set timeout 120
set ifaddr 10.0.0.1/0 10.0.0.2/0 255.255.255.0 0.0.0.0
add default HISADDR
enable dns

запускаем ppp, пишем load PTN, пишем dial
И немедленно выпил.
Спасибо сказали:
Джон
Сообщения: 8

Re: Поддержка dialup

Сообщение Джон »

Для polachok:

как я понял, конфиг надо править так:

default:
set phone <номер дозвона>
set device <модем в dev/>
set speed <??? 115200 Это что такое? Скорость? kbit/s / bit/s ? И что с ней
делать, если скорость моего провайдера всё время меняется?>
set dial "ABORT BUSY ABORT NO\\sCARRIER TIMEOUT 5 \"\" AT \ OK-AT-OK ATE1Q0
OK \\dATDP\\T TIMEOUT 60 CONNECT"
< В эту строку я вообще что-то не впёр, если можно, объясни
пожалуйста ... >
set authname <мой логин>
set authkey <мой пароль>
set timeout <??? timeout чего?>
set ifaddr 10.0.0.1/0 10.0.0.2/0 255.255.255.0 0.0.0.0
< IP адреса ... Маски подсети ... Какой ещё нахрен сети???>
set default HISADDR
< Это что такое ??? >
enable dns <Отключение DNS, но зачем оно вообще требуется для dialup'а?>
PTN:
...

И ещё: кому не лень, пожалуйста, помогите начинающему любителю FreeBSD установить и настроить модем Rockwell 56000 External Modem PnP в этой системе ... Всем откликнувшимся заранее спасибо.
Спасибо сказали:
Аватара пользователя
polachok
Бывший модератор
Сообщения: 2199
Статус: главный форумный маргинал
ОС: gnu/linux

Re: Поддержка dialup

Сообщение polachok »

set speed скорость в бодах наверное. ставь как у меня.
set dial "ABORT BUSY ABORT NO\\sCARRIER TIMEOUT 5 \"\" AT \ OK-AT-OK ATE1Q0
OK \\dATDP\\T TIMEOUT 60 CONNECT"
преставать звонить если: занято, нет несущей, и тд. в ман!
set timeout
отключения при неактивности в сети
set ifaddr 10.0.0.1/0 10.0.0.2/0 255.255.255.0 0.0.0.0
обыкновенной сети, диал-апной
set default HISADDR
трафик через диал-ап пускать
enable dns
включение dns.

PS возможно в описании каких-либо опция я ошибаюсь. если требуется узнать их точное значение обращайтесь к дефолтному примеру либо к man ppp (а лучше к тому и другому), а также к handbook
И немедленно выпил.
Спасибо сказали:
sNEO
Сообщения: 32

Re: Поддержка dialup

Сообщение sNEO »

Недале как вчера установил BSD 5.3, так же инересуюсь выходом в инет из консоли, т.к. Х пока не настроил, небольшие проблемы с ним.
Меня смущают эти строки:
set authname "e9ysuP72"
set authkey "8v7nt96u"
ведь любой, даже с удаленного доступа может просмотреть обычным образом cat /etc/ppp/ppp.conf и узнать логин и пароль? Как же так?
И еще вопросец есть ли броузер под консоль, что бы не из графики по сайтам лазить?
Спасибо сказали:
Аватара пользователя
zenwolf
Бывший модератор
Сообщения: 3139
Статус: Страшный и злой
ОС: Slackware..Salix..x86_64

Re: Поддержка dialup

Сообщение zenwolf »

sNEO писал(а):
17.11.2005 05:55
Недале как вчера установил BSD 5.3, так же инересуюсь выходом в инет из консоли, т.к. Х пока не настроил, небольшие проблемы с ним.
Меня смущают эти строки:
set authname "e9ysuP72"
set authkey "8v7nt96u"
ведь любой, даже с удаленного доступа может просмотреть обычным образом cat /etc/ppp/ppp.conf и узнать логин и пароль? Как же так?
И еще вопросец есть ли броузер под консоль, что бы не из графики по сайтам лазить?

а как он посмотрит удалённо ? если у тебя этот доступ закрыт и файрволл работает и под пользователем ты сидишь ? и плюс зачем вобще какие то порты открывать дома ?

браузеров куча консольных- links,elinks,w3m,lynx
Quae videmus quo dependet vultus. (лат) - То, что мы видим, зависит от того, куда мы смотрим.
Спасибо сказали:
sNEO
Сообщения: 32

Re: Поддержка dialup

Сообщение sNEO »

Вот я о том и говорю, вдруг у меня там все открыто, я в этом если чесно мало разбираюсь как открывать и закрывать всякие порты, если честно я вообще не имею ни малейшего представления что за порты и как они выглядят.
Спасибо сказали:
Аватара пользователя
Poor Fred
Сообщения: 1575
Статус: Pygoscelis papua
ОС: Gentoo Linux, FreeBSD

Re: Поддержка dialup

Сообщение Poor Fred »

sNEO писал(а):
17.11.2005 06:36
Вот я о том и говорю, вдруг у меня там все открыто, я в этом если чесно мало разбираюсь как открывать и закрывать всякие порты, если честно я вообще не имею ни малейшего представления что за порты и как они выглядят.


ppp запускается от рута. Вот и поставь на ppp.conf права 600 - другим в него нечего смотреть.

А как закрывать порты - надо учиться. :D

Для начала:
firewall_enable = "YES"
firewall_type = "client"
firewall_logging = "YES" #<-- это для начала, чтобы смотреть в /var/log/security и разбираться, почему тебя в и-нет не пускают, потом можно и выключить.

Это все в /etc/rc.conf.


А также долго и пристально смотришь в /etc/rc.firewall и разбираешься, что там написано.
Убить всех человеков!
Спасибо сказали:
Аватара пользователя
polachok
Бывший модератор
Сообщения: 2199
Статус: главный форумный маргинал
ОС: gnu/linux

Re: Поддержка dialup

Сообщение polachok »

да не парьтесь вы так! (впрочем немного осторожности не помешает)
1.nmap 127.0.0.1 (secutity/nmap)
вывод сюда
2.без telnet/ssh никто к вам не залогинится
3.по умолчанию у файла /etc/ppp/ppp.conf права и так соответсвующие
4.толку от включения firewall без настройки правил нет никакого
5.я вот никогда не использовал никаких файрволов и до сих пор жив. Разве что security/portsentry поставил.
И немедленно выпил.
Спасибо сказали:
Джон
Сообщения: 8

Re: Поддержка dialup

Сообщение Джон »

При запуске PPP выдаёт ошибку:

# ppp ON
ON: Configuration label not found

Подскажите, в чём может быть ошибка (man не предлагать)
Спасибо сказали:
Аватара пользователя
polachok
Бывший модератор
Сообщения: 2199
Статус: главный форумный маргинал
ОС: gnu/linux

Re: Поддержка dialup

Сообщение polachok »

очевидно нет такой настройки. конфиг в студию
И немедленно выпил.
Спасибо сказали:
sNEO
Сообщения: 32

Re: Поддержка dialup

Сообщение sNEO »

Может я что-то не то делаю. Почему в консоли не грузятся страницы интернета.
Я делаю так:
ppp
load provider
dial
соединение устанавливается, потом набираю
shell
выходит в оболочку, набираю
links
запускается браузер
там набираю адресс, а он внизу пишет поиск хоста, и все, я ждал несколько минут, а он не загружает.
Через Х все работает нормально. Может я что-то не правильно делаю?
FreeBSD 5.4
Спасибо сказали:
Аватара пользователя
zenwolf
Бывший модератор
Сообщения: 3139
Статус: Страшный и злой
ОС: Slackware..Salix..x86_64

Re: Поддержка dialup

Сообщение zenwolf »

в /etc/resolv.conf dns-серверы прова прописанны ?
Quae videmus quo dependet vultus. (лат) - То, что мы видим, зависит от того, куда мы смотрим.
Спасибо сказали:
-error
Сообщения: 174
Статус: sysadmin / oracle dba
ОС: HP-UX :-)

Re: Поддержка dialup

Сообщение -error »

2sNEO: посмотри сначала ping/traceroute на тот адрес, куда браузером попасть хочешь. глядишь, все и прояснится.
Спасибо сказали:
Джон
Сообщения: 8

Re: Поддержка dialup

Сообщение Джон »

Извините, что долго не писал ответ, не имел доступа в Интернет.

Короче, выкладываю конфиг /etc/ppp/ppp.conf:

default:
set phone ISPNUMBER

//
// Здесь я поставил cuaa0, потому что у меня модем подключён к порту COM1.

set device /dev/cuaa0
set speed 115200
set dial "ABORT BUSY ABORT NO\\sCARRIER TIMEOUT 5 \
\"\" AT OK-AT-OK ATE1Q0 OK \\dATDT\\T TIMEOUT 60 CONNECT"
set authname USERNAME
set authkey PASSWORD
set timeout 180
enable dns
set default HISADDR

dial_connect:
set phone <MYISPNUMBER>
set authname <MYUSERNAME>
set authkey <MYPASSWORD>
set dial "ABORT BUSY ABORT NO\\sCARRIER TIMEOUT 5 \
\"\" AT OK-AT-OK ATE1Q0 OK \\dATDT\\T TIMEOUT 60 CONNECT"
set timeout 180
enable dns
set ifaddr 10.0.0.1/0 10.0.0.2/0 255.255.255.0 0.0.0.0
set default HISADDR

Вот, ещё раз спрашиваю, в чём может быть ошибка ???
[ # ppp ON
ON: Configuration label not found ]
Спасибо сказали:
Аватара пользователя
vg2.0
Сообщения: 832
Статус: *BSD admin ;)
ОС: *BSD =)

Re: Поддержка dialup

Сообщение vg2.0 »

Попробуйте вот этот конфиг

Код: Выделить всё

#################################################################
# PPP  Sample Configuration File
# Originally written by Toshiharu OHNO
# Simplified 5/14/1999 by wself@cdrom.com
#
# See /usr/share/examples/ppp/ for some examples
#
# $FreeBSD: src/etc/ppp/ppp.conf,v 1.10 2004/11/19 17:12:56 obrien Exp $
#################################################################

default:
 set log Phase Chat LCP IPCP CCP tun command
 ident user-ppp VERSION (built COMPILATIONDATE)

 # Ensure that "device" references the correct serial port
 # for your modem. (cuad0 = COM1, cuad1 = COM2)
 #
 set device /dev/cuad0

 set speed 115200
 set dial "ABORT BUSY ABORT NO\\sCARRIER TIMEOUT 5 \
           \"\" AT OK-AT-OK ATE1Q0 OK \\dATDP\\T TIMEOUT 40 CONNECT"
 # set timeout 180                      # 3 minute idle timer (the default)
 enable dns                             # request DNS info (for resolv.conf)

#papchap:
 #
 # edit the next three lines and replace the items in caps with
 # the values which have been assigned by your ISP.
 #

provider:
 set phone 8,773
 set authname 773
 set authkey 773

 set ifaddr 10.0.0.1/0 10.0.0.2/0 255.255.255.255
 add default HISADDR                    # Add a (sticky) default route


Замените имя устройства, логин и пароль на свои. Применять так:
ppp
dial provider
quit
FreeBSD 6-stable
FreeBSD 5.5-stable
Спасибо сказали:
Джон
Сообщения: 8

Re: Поддержка dialup

Сообщение Джон »

После правки конфига, я запустил ppp, но не работает команда dial. Подскажите как исправить.

Код: Выделить всё

 # ppp
Working in interactive mode
Using interface: tun0
ppp ON localhost> dial provider
Warning: set default: Invalid command
Warning: set default: Failed 1
ppp ON localhost> Chat script failed
Спасибо сказали:
Аватара пользователя
polachok
Бывший модератор
Сообщения: 2199
Статус: главный форумный маргинал
ОС: gnu/linux

Re: Поддержка dialup

Сообщение polachok »

конфиг в студию... полностью.
И немедленно выпил.
Спасибо сказали:
Toptyg
Сообщения: 78

Re: Поддержка dialup

Сообщение Toptyg »

==================================
default:
set log Phase Chat LCP IPCP CCP tun command
ident user-ppp VERSION (built COMPILATIONDATE)
# Ensure that "device" references the correct serial port
# for your modem. (cuaa0 = COM1, cuaa1 = COM2)
#
set device /dev/cuaa1

set speed 115200
set dial "ABORT BUSY ABORT NO\\sCARRIER TIMEOUT 5 \
\"\" AT OK-AT-OK ATE1Q0 OK \\dATDT\\T TIMEOUT 40 CONNECT"
set timeout 180 # 3 minute idle timer (the default)
enable dns # request DNS info (for resolv.conf)

papchap:
#
# edit the next three lines and replace the items in caps with
# the values which have been assigned by your ISP.
#
set phone p4311212
set authname ppkey
set authkey peterlink
set device /dev/cual0 //устройство
set ifaddr 10.0.0.1/0 10.0.0.2/0 255.255.255.0 0.0.0.0
add default HISADDR # Add a (sticky) default route
============================================
затем в консоле
ppp -ddial papchap
-=<< FreeBsD 6.2 >>=-
Спасибо сказали:
Аватара пользователя
vg2.0
Сообщения: 832
Статус: *BSD admin ;)
ОС: *BSD =)

Re: Поддержка dialup

Сообщение vg2.0 »

Попробуй так, я поправил. Если на com1, то должно все заработать.

Код: Выделить всё

==================================
default:
 set log Phase Chat LCP IPCP CCP tun command
 ident user-ppp VERSION (built COMPILATIONDATE)
 # Ensure that "device" references the correct serial port
 # for your modem. (cuaa0 = COM1, cuaa1 = COM2)
 #
 set device /dev/cuaa0

 set speed 115200
 set dial "ABORT BUSY ABORT NO\\sCARRIER TIMEOUT 5 \
           \"\" AT OK-AT-OK ATE1Q0 OK \\dATDP\\T TIMEOUT 40 CONNECT"
 set timeout 0                       # 3 minute idle timer (the default)
 enable dns                # request DNS info (for resolv.conf)

papchap:
 #
 # edit the next three lines and replace the items in caps with
 # the values which have been assigned by your ISP.
 #
 set phone p4311212
 set authname ppkey
 set authkey peterlink
set device /dev/cuaa0
  set ifaddr 10.0.0.1/0 10.0.0.2/0 255.255.255.0 0.0.0.0
 add default HISADDR            # Add a (sticky) default route
============================================
FreeBSD 6-stable
FreeBSD 5.5-stable
Спасибо сказали:
Аватара пользователя
zenwolf
Бывший модератор
Сообщения: 3139
Статус: Страшный и злой
ОС: Slackware..Salix..x86_64

Re: Поддержка dialup

Сообщение zenwolf »

пробуй так -
# ppp papchap

потом повиться приглашение к ввоводу :
>

вводим :
>term

далее курсор перескачит на другую строку там введи

atz

тут он снова дожен перескочить на другую стороку
,далее вводим :

atdtxxxxxxxx

ясно что вместо xxxxx должен быть номер куда звонить ,впринципе всё !(делается всё под рутом)
Quae videmus quo dependet vultus. (лат) - То, что мы видим, зависит от того, куда мы смотрим.
Спасибо сказали:
Аватара пользователя
polachok
Бывший модератор
Сообщения: 2199
Статус: главный форумный маргинал
ОС: gnu/linux

Re: Поддержка dialup

Сообщение polachok »

ABORT BUSY ABORT NO\\sCARRIER TIMEOUT 5 \
\"\" AT OK-AT-OK ATE1Q0 OK \\dATDT\\T TIMEOUT 40 CONNECT"
уверены?
И немедленно выпил.
Спасибо сказали:
fixx
Сообщения: 430
Статус: индивид
ОС: fedora

Re: Поддержка dialup

Сообщение fixx »

а как узнать время текущего соединения и трафик? что-то не соображу никак
Спасибо сказали:
fixx
Сообщения: 430
Статус: индивид
ОС: fedora

Re: Поддержка dialup

Сообщение fixx »

неужели нельзя? в логах только после разьединения пишется, а мне хотелось бы текущую статистику смотреть, на сколько насидел.
Спасибо сказали:
fixx
Сообщения: 430
Статус: индивид
ОС: fedora

Re: Поддержка dialup

Сообщение fixx »

show physical

может пригодится кому
Спасибо сказали:
Аватара пользователя
fonya
Сообщения: 203
ОС: linux

Re: Поддержка dialup

Сообщение fonya »

fixx писал(а):
23.10.2006 12:17
неужели нельзя? в логах только после разьединения пишется, а мне хотелось бы текущую статистику смотреть, на сколько насидел.

Knemo,gkrellm,kppp - все это вам покажет?
Я не волшебник,я только учусь,но дружба помогает делать настоящие чудеса!
Особенно в *nix.
Спасибо сказали:
fixx
Сообщения: 430
Статус: индивид
ОС: fedora

Re: Поддержка dialup

Сообщение fixx »

fonya
конечно покажет, у меня сейчас knemo и стоит. интересно было, как без gui узанть.
Спасибо сказали: